Best Auto Loans and Financing of May 2025 – CNBC
Product Details:
Auto loans for new and used vehicles, refinancing options available from various lenders including Capital One, PenFed, MyAutoLoan, Carvana, CarMax, and Autopay.
Technical Parameters:
– APR varies by lender and credit profile, starting from 4.44% to 7.90%
– Loan amounts range from $4,000 to $150,000 depending on the lender
– Loan terms available from 24 to 84 months
– No early payoff penalties for most lenders
Application Scenarios:
– Purchasing a new vehicle
– Purchasing a used vehicle
– Refinancing an existing car loan
– Private party purchases and lease buyouts
Pros:
– Competitive rates available for borrowers with bad credit
– Prequalification options available without hard credit checks
– Convenient online tools for vehicle browsing and loan term estimation
– No early payoff fees for most lenders
Cons:
– Some lenders require credit union membership
– Limited customer service for certain online platforms
– Final loan terms must be obtained at participating dealers for some lenders
– Late payment fees may apply depending on the lender

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What should I look for in a car manufacturer when seeking financing options?
When choosing a car manufacturer for financing, look for those with established relationships with banks and financial institutions. Check if they offer flexible financing terms, competitive interest rates, and a variety of loan options. Additionally, consider their reputation for customer service and support throughout the financing process.
How can I find car manufacturers that offer financing?
You can start by researching online and visiting manufacturer websites to see if they have financing programs. Additionally, local dealerships often have partnerships with specific manufacturers that provide financing options. Networking with industry contacts and attending trade shows can also help you discover manufacturers with financing solutions.
Are there specific car manufacturers known for easier financing?
Yes, some manufacturers like Toyota, Honda, and Ford are often recognized for having straightforward financing processes and partnerships with multiple lenders. They typically provide a range of financing options and have a solid reputation for customer support, making it easier for buyers to secure loans.
What documents do I need to apply for financing through a manufacturer?
Typically, you’ll need proof of income, employment verification, credit history, and identification. Some manufacturers may also require additional documents like proof of residency or a down payment. It’s best to check with the specific manufacturer for their exact requirements.
Can I negotiate financing terms with car manufacturers?
Yes, you can negotiate financing terms with car manufacturers, just like you would with any loan. Don’t hesitate to discuss interest rates, loan duration, and down payment options. Being informed about current market rates can also empower you to negotiate better terms that fit your budget.
